
Battery energy storage systems (BESS) offer businesses several cost-related advantages, primarily through operational efficiency and strategic energy management:
1. Peak Shaving and Load Shifting
BESS reduces energy expenses by storing electricity during off-peak periods (when prices are low) and discharging it during peak-demand hours (when prices are high). This minimizes demand charges and optimizes energy procurement costs.
2. Reduced Grid Reliance
By decreasing dependence on grid electricity—especially during high-cost peak times—businesses can lower operational expenses. This also mitigates risks associated with volatile energy prices.
3. Backup Power Savings
BESS provides uninterrupted power during outages, preventing revenue loss from operational downtime and avoiding costs linked to disrupted critical services (e.g., data centers or manufacturing lines).
4. Renewable Energy Optimization
Pairing BESS with renewables like solar allows businesses to maximize self-consumption of cheap, self-generated energy, reducing reliance on grid-sourced power and fossil fuels.
5. Long-Term Financial Benefits
Despite high upfront costs, BESS offers sustained savings through lower electricity bills, potential revenue from grid services (e.g., frequency regulation), and increased property value. Declining battery prices further enhance ROI over time.
Comparative Cost Savings
| Factor | Impact |
|---|---|
| Peak Demand Charges | Reduces by 20–40% through load shifting |
| Outage Mitigation | Avoids losses from downtime (critical for sectors like healthcare) |
| Renewable Integration | Lowers energy costs by maximizing solar/wind use |
| Grid Services Revenue | Additional income from ancillary services (e.g., voltage support) |
